I tried installing astah-community package from Change Vision (http://astah.change-vision.com/en/product/astah-community.html) by dowloading a .deb package and double-clicking it. Software center constantly showed that package is installing. I had to kill software-center and few other processes (dpkg etc.).
Then I tried installing it from the console with dpkg -i command.
It turned out, that te package requires user to see the license (opened by less) and type 'yes' to accept it. GDebi seems to support it, but software-center doesn't, what makes such packages uninstallable for less advanced users.
